Bavarian Nordic announces exercise of 44 MUSD option by the US government
The U.S. Biomedical Advanced Research and Development Authority (BARDA) have exercised another option under the ongoing contract for freeze-dried MVA-BN smallpox vaccine. Cobra Biologics wins Innovate UK award
Cobra Biologics, Pall Corporation and the Cell and Gene Therapy Catapult win £1.5M innovate UK grant. Cobra Biologics has won a £1.5m shared grant from Innovate UK, the United Kingdom’s innovation agency. RetiPharma secures funding from the BII
RetiPharma has secured funding from the Novo Nordisk Foundation’s BioInnovation Institute (BII) to develop treatments of degenerative eye disorders. The funding will be used to prepare its lead drug RP001 for a clinical proof-of-concept study in patients with retinal detachment as well as to in source additional compounds using RetiPharma’s translational platform. Alligator Bioscience receives government research grant
The company will receive a 500 000 SEK grant from Sweden’s government agency for innovation, Vinnova, for the project “Verification of the unique functionality of ATOR-1017 by 3D structure determination”. Immunicum raises 352 MSEK
Immunicum raises SEK 351M in a directed issue and a fully guaranteed rights issue for continued clinical development of Ilixadencel – a new cancer immunotherapy.
